Looking for love on Facebook, he found blackmailers instead
A clerk, who was separated from his wife, fell into the clutches of a couple from Saronno, who have now been arrested by the Carabinieri, after extorting €30,000 out of him, by threatening to report him as a paedophile. T
He met a woman on Facebook and ended up in an extortion racket that almost left him destitute. This is the story of a 40-year-old man from Arluno, who, thanks to the Carabinieri, managed to save himself from a couple from Saronno, who had caught him in a trap that he could not get out of. The man, who is separated, met a woman on Facebook in December 2012, and started to chat online with her every day, even exchanging telephone numbers. They eventually began to text each other, also sending very explicit messages, without having actually met in person. The clerk, from Arluno, did not suspect that behind those messages there was a couple, who were playing with him and his feelings. Suddenly, the trap closed; after a short time, the man received a phone call from the number of the alleged new friend, but the voice on the line was not that of the beloved woman, but a man’s. “The woman you’ve been chatting with is actually my daughter, a 13-year-old girl,” is what he was told.
The trap had sprung and from that moment on he kept receiving threats and blackmail demands, which he paid regularly, in different places, to the man and his wife, to a total of almost €30,000. The victim was frightened by the continual threats from the unscrupulous couple. “We’ll tell your employer everything,” they said. Or even worse: “We’ll tell everyone you’re a paedophile.” In fact, there was no girl, it was all a fraud created by a married couple, a 42-year-old man and a 50-year-old woman, who were both unemployed. Fed up with the continual demands, the victim eventually decided to go to the Carabinieri in Arluno, who accompanied him to the last appointment, when he should have paid his blackmailers €1000 in cash; as the money was being handed over, the Carabinieri arrested the two criminals for extorsion. They were then taken to San Vittore Prison, in Milan, where their arrest was confirmed by the investigating magistrate.
